Abstract:

Angkor wat is a temple complex in Cambodia which is the largest religious monument in the world till date.  The site of Angkor wat is measured 162.6 hectares. This Angkor wat temple is dedicated to Lord Vishnu which is built by Khmer Empire. It is one of UNESCO World Heritage sites. It was built in 12th Centruary by Suryavarman II.  Angkor wat is also called as world’s oldest man- made Island. It is one of the most preserved temples in Angkor group of temples, which includes around 100. It is the world’s largent Hindu Temple.  The original name of Angkor wat is Parama Vishnu Lokha, which means sacred world of Lord Vishnu.
